The Criminal Procedure Act of 1950 section 17, which is still in force states this: “17. Detention of persons arrested without warrant. When any person has been taken into custody without a warrant for an offence other than murder, treason or rape, the officer in charge of the police station to which the person is brought may in any case and shall, if it does not appear practicable to bring the person before an appropriate magistrate’s court within twenty-four hours after he or she was so taken into custody, inquire into the case, and, unless the offence appears to the officer to be of a serious nature, release the person on his or her executing a bond, with or without sureties, for a reasonable amount to appear before a magistrate’s court at a time and place to be named in the bond; but where any person is retained in custody, he or she shall be brought before a magistrate’s court as soon as practicable. An officer in charge of a police station may discharge a person arrested on suspicion on any charge when, after due police inquiry, insufficient evidence is, in his or her opinion, disclosed on which to proceed with a charge” (Criminal Procedure Act of 1950).
So it is not like there are laws to this. But as the spin has gone, most likely the Criminal Procedure isn’t as important as the Penal Code Act of 1950 subsection 24, which states: “24. Penalty for acts intended to alarm, annoy or ridicule the President. Any person who, with intent to alarm or annoy or ridicule the President— (a) wilfully throws any matter or substance at or upon the person of the President; (b) wilfully strikes the person of the President; or (c) assaults or wrongfully restrains the person of the President, commits an offence and is liable to imprisonment for life” (Penal Code Act of 1950).
